You have had a vast improvement in grass Cure. Have you moved cattle more often, cut numbers or do you give the credit to Climate Change :roll: and more rain?
 
gcreekrch said:
You have had a vast improvement in grass Cure. Have you moved cattle more often, cut numbers or do you give the credit to Climate Change :roll: and more rain?
We have done a little of everything first we started by making the guy that shares the permit with us accountable for the numbers he turns out. Second we cut our numbers and started running the cows on hay fields next to our permit for a couple of months before we turn out. Third we started moving cows to new areas once a week and plus we now have a fence that divides the permit in half so we can now close gates and keep them out of different areas.
